One Day Trip
If you're looking for a quick getaway in Brasov and want to explore only the most important tourist attractions, you can visit the city in a single day. During this time, you can walk through the old town center, admire the historical buildings, and visit the most important tourist attractions.
Panoramic view from the top of Tâmpa
Furthermore, you can enjoy a cable car ride to the summit of Mount Tampa, which offers a panoramic view of the city and its surroundings.
Minimum 3-day Stay
In order to make the most of your journey and fully experience the charms of the old town center, we would like to recommend extending your stay to at least 4 days. This will give you ample time to leisurely explore the winding streets and soak up the atmosphere of a bygone era. Take your time to admire the many examples of medieval architecture that are scattered throughout the city, such as the stunning Black Church, the ornate White Tower, the impressive Weaver's Bastion, and the bustling Council Square, which serves as a hub for both locals and tourists alike. In addition to these attractions, there are also several other lesser-known gems that are waiting to be discovered, such as the hidden alleyways filled with picturesque houses and the quaint artisan shops that sell traditional handicrafts. If you want to explore the mountainous landscape around the city, plan to spend at least a week in the area to fully immerse yourself in the surrounding mountains. This will allow you to take your time and explore the many hiking trails that wind through the Carpathian Mountains, offering stunning vistas and breathtaking natural beauty. You can also take the opportunity to visit the many charming mountain towns in the area, each with its own unique culture and history.
